Michael Cole and Tazz introduced and previewed the event.

 

1 -- EDDIE GUERRERO vs. LUTHER REIGNS (w/Mark Jindrak)

 

It can't thrill the fragile psyche of Guerrero to be working an opening PPV match. After a fast-paced opening minute or two of back and forth action, Reigns began working over Guerrero's back. He bent Guerrero backwards over his knee. Guerrero kneed out of it and bailed out to ringside. Back in the ring Reigns gave Guerrero another backbreaker and bent his back over his knee. Guerrero blocked a move by Reigns and countered by pushing his feet off the top rope and slammed Reigns backward. Cole called it an "inverted DDT," which is code for Cole saying, "I have no idea what to call it but it involved someone wrapping their arms around their opponent's head. At 10:00 Guerrero went for his Three Amigos vertical suplex series. On the third suplex attempt, Reigns blocked it and dropped Guerrero face-first onto the mat. Guerrero bailed out to ringside. He yanked an object away from a security cop standing in the front row. He then hid it in his boot, reentered the ring, and dropkicked a chair-wielding Reigns into Jindrak, who was standing on the ring apron. Guerrero then went for a Frog Splash, but Reigns moved. Guerrero then yanked the stolen object (an "extension baton") out of his boot and hit Reigns with it, then landed his Frog Splash for the win.

 

WINNER: Guerrero at 13:13.

 

STAR RATING: *3/4 -- Okay match. Nothing wrong with it at all. It played into Guerrero's gimmick of "lying, cheating, and stealing" while giving Reigns an out for losing.
